What are Conex Containers?
Conex containers are standardized metal containers used for transferring goods. Originally created for shipping by sea, these containers are now commonly used for storage, short-term housing, and even ingenious architectural tasks. The term "Conex" originated from the term "container express," which encapsulated the essence of expedited shipping.

The history of Conex containers go back to the early 1950s. The intro of the ISO standardization enabled intermodal transport, assisting in smooth cargo movement by rail, road, and sea. The standardization also made sure resilience and security, making them perfect for long-distance travels. Over the years, the design and structure have actually developed to include contemporary amenities, consisting of insulation for temperature-sensitive products and integrated RFID innovation for tracking deliveries.

Conex containers present various benefits throughout different applications:
Durability and Strength
Constructed from high-quality steel, these containers are developed to stand up to extreme climate condition and are resistant to rust.
Cost-Effectiveness
Compared to conventional construction methods or storage facilities, Conex containers are an affordable choice. Their accessibility in the used market can significantly decrease costs.
Customizability
Containers can be modified to match particular requirements, consisting of the addition of windows, doors, electrical systems, and HVAC systems.
Mobility
Quickly easily transportable, they can be moved using trucks or cranes, making them a perfect choice for moving workplaces or temporary setups.
Security
Lockable and sturdy in nature, Conex containers provide an added layer of security for important products.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How much do Conex containers cost?
The cost of a Conex container varies extensively based on size, condition (new vs. used), and modifications. Normally, used containers can range from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 3,500, while new containers might cost between ₤ 3,000 and ₤ 5,000.
2. Do Conex containers require permits for installation?
It depends on regional regulations. Numerous municipalities need permits for container usage, especially if they are modified or used for residential purposes. Always check regional zoning laws.
3. What is the life-span of a Conex container?
A properly maintained Conex container can last between 10 to 25 years, depending on environmental conditions and use.
4. Can Conex containers be insulated?
Yes, containers can be insulated to guarantee heat in chillier climates or to manage temperature-sensitive merchandise. Expert insulation techniques exist to maintain structural stability.
5. Are Conex containers eco-friendly?
Yes, repurposing Conex containers for different uses can decrease waste and lower the carbon footprint connected with traditional construction techniques.
6. How do I choose the best size Conex container?
Think about the intended usage, storage requirements, and available space. Requirement sizes include 20-foot and 40-foot containers, but there are several sizes offered to fulfill different requirements.
